1.1. Applications are invited online for recruitment to the post of Grama Mahila
Samrakshana Karyadarsi / Ward Mahila Samrakshana Karyadarsi (762 posts)
in A.P. from eligible Women candidates within the age group of 1B to 42years
as on 01.07.2020. The Grama Mahila Samrakshana Karyadarsi / Ward Mahila
Samrakshana Karyadarsi post carries the pay scale of Rs.14,600-44,870 in RPS
2015.
Note:- The candidates on selection and appointment will be paid Rs. 15,000/-
PM as consolidated pay for a period of 2 years. They will be given regular scale of
pay after satisfactory completion of 2 years probation. The selected candidates on
appointment will be deployed to work in the Village Secretariats / Ward Secretariats
established in the Grama Panchayats / ULBs as per G.O.Ms.No. 110, Panchayati Raj
and Rural Development (MDL-1) department dated, 19.07.2019 / G.O. Ms. No. 217,
/
MA&UD (UBS) Dept. Dt. 20-07-2019 G.O.Ms.No.153, Panchayat Raj and Rural
Development (MDL-1) department, Dt:04-10-20 19.

PARA-10 SCHEME OF EXA INATION
The Scheme & Syllabus for the examination has been shown in Annexure-ll.
PARA - 11: CENTRES FOR WRITTEN EXAMINAUON:
The candidate has to choose a district of her choice for appearing for the
OMR based written examination. She can accordingly indicate the order
of preference of 3 districts among which she will be allotted to one of
the examination centres as per administrative convenience. However
best efFort will be made to accommodate the candidate in 1* or 2nd
choice district.
PARA -
12 RESOLUTION OF DISPUTES RELATED TO OUESTION PAPER,
ANSWER KEY AND OTHER MATTERS
12.1. The key will be published in the website after conduct of the
examination. Any objections with regard to the key and any other matter
shall be flled within 3 days after publication of the key in the prescribed
proforma available in the website.
12.2. The objections received in the prescribed proforma and within due date
will be referred to Expert Committee for opinion and to take appropriate
decision thereon by the Depaftment. As per decision of the Department a
revised key will be hosted and it will be final. In the event of any
question found improper by the expert committee, it will be reckoned for
adding marks for all the candidates.
12.3. Any objection filed after expiry of specified time from the date of
publication of key would not be entertained.

15.1. Each District is the unit of appointment. District Selection Committee (DSC) is
the selection authority and the District Collector is the appointing authority. The
DSC will follow the principle of order of merit and the selection process is
carried out with utmost regard to secrecy and confidentiality so as to ensure
that the principle of merit is scrupulously followed The committee of Secretaries
constituted under G.O.RI. No. 449, PR & RD (MDL-l), dated 19.07.2019 will
provide suppoft for the conduct of the examination.
15.2. The selection of candidates for appointment to the posts shall be based on the
merit in the OMR based written examination, to be held as per the scheme of
examination enunciated at para 10 above.
15.3. Government reserves the right to decided cut off marks. The minimum
qualitying marks to the candidates of various categories, will be decided basing
on the need.
15.4. Where the candidates get equal number of marks in the OMR based written
examination if two or more candidates get equal total number of marks, those
candidates shall be bracketed. Candidates within the same bracket shall then be
ranked 1, 2, 3 etc., according to age i.e., oldest being considered for admission.
In case there is tie in age, the person who possesses educational qualificatlon at
earlier date would be consldered.
A weightage of 1.5 marks for every completed period of Six (6) months of
satisfactory service rendered as Contract, Outsourcing & Home Guard in the
Department of Home to a maximum of 15 marks. The Service Certificate should
be issued by the Unit Officer concerned. The service rendered for less than Six
(6) months shall be treated as NIL.
15.6. The appointment of selected candidates will be subject to their being found
medically fit in the appropriate medical classification, and if she is of sound
health, active habits and free from any bodily defect or infirmity.
15.7. In the event of a candidate gettlng selected to a post, she should stay/reside in
the Village / Ward where she is posted.
15.8. ANSWER KEY AND MARKS: Answer key would be published on the website and
marks of
each candidate are also displayed on website. No separate
memorandum of marks would be issued.

C.9. (a) Wherever the candidates are totally blind, they will be provided a scribe to
write the examination and 20 minutes extra time is permitted to them per hour.
Eligible candidates are also allowed to bring their own scribe after due
intimation to the Department after duly providing the full identification details of
the scribe like name, address and appropriate proof of identification.
(b) The applicants shall upload the certificate relating to percentage of disability
for considering the appointment of scribe in the examlnation.
(c) An extra time of 20 minutes per hour is also permitted for the candidates
with locomotor disability and CEREBRAL PALSY where dominant (writing)
extremity is affected for the extent slowing the performance of function
(Minimum of 40o/o impairment). No scribe is allowed to such candidates.
(d)The candidate as well as the scribe will have to give a suitable undeftaking
conforming to the rules applicable
